To mark the fourth anniversary of the disappearance and death of Hillary Angel Wilson, friends and family gathered for a walk and candle light service.
On August 20, 2009, 18-year-old Wilson’s body was found in a field. Her murder has not been solved.

Her family hosted a Justice for Hillary Memorial Walk Monday morning where they marched to the Manitoba Legislature. Later, mourners gathered again at the Legislature for a candle light vigil.
Wilson’s mother says it’s cultural tradition to stop after four memorials but she won’t stop looking for justice, “I wish this and many other cases could get solved,” she told Global News. “I’m patiently waiting and trying to do what I can.”
